Linux数据库高效部署与稳定运行配置精要
|
2026AI模拟图,仅供参考 在Linux系统中部署数据库,需优先选择适合业务场景的数据库类型。MySQL、PostgreSQL和MariaDB是常见选项,它们均支持高并发与数据一致性。安装前应确保系统已更新至最新版本,并配置好防火墙规则,仅开放必要的端口如3306或5432。使用包管理器如apt或yum安装数据库时,建议启用官方软件源以获取稳定版本。安装完成后,立即运行安全初始化脚本,设置root密码,移除匿名用户,并禁用远程root登录,提升系统安全性。 数据库配置文件通常位于/etc/mysql/my.cnf或/etc/postgresql/conf.d/目录下。关键参数如innodb_buffer_pool_size应根据物理内存合理设定,一般建议为总内存的70%~80%,避免过度分配导致系统内存不足。 日志管理对稳定性至关重要。启用错误日志与慢查询日志,并定期归档清理,防止日志文件无限增长占用磁盘空间。可通过logrotate工具实现自动轮转,同时监控日志内容,及时发现异常操作。 定时备份是保障数据安全的核心措施。推荐使用mysqldump或pg_dump结合cron任务进行每日全量备份,重要数据可配合增量备份策略。备份文件应存储于独立分区或远程服务器,避免本地故障导致数据丢失。 性能监控不可忽视。通过systemd服务状态、top、htop等工具观察资源使用情况,结合Prometheus与Grafana构建可视化监控体系,实时掌握数据库连接数、QPS及响应延迟等指标。 定期更新数据库补丁与操作系统补丁,防范已知漏洞。同时建立变更管理流程,所有配置修改需经过测试环境验证后再上线,确保生产环境的稳定性与可追溯性。 (编辑:站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|

